Transaction 7895739630eb36780b03419fd46c987237bc573e9167a2cf0a2949dd03701cd9
1 Input
-
729c72315fdb32c3b06e3a13495b768ac6c01b66bf76426b3cc92782edfc90c9:46
OP_DATA_48(48) 44022036a8159c829ae61f6be65229871cbfdbd5781bf9958daa3ec62c4aa580e49d4a022048b48575feeccd484a5680
1 Outputs
- 7895739630eb36780b03419fd46c987237bc573e9167a2cf0a2949dd03701cd9:0
value 685670
address 12PX3PaC3sd1RuFtxosnzu166cSR1xKVFw